Blood Oath (Mafia Elite, book 2) by Amy McKinley

5 out of 5 stars

I can’t get enough of this series!! Amy McKinley knocks another one out of the park. Nothing hotter than a growly Mafia man attracted to a strong, kickass Mafia woman. Sign me up!

The story picks up with Lil and Max on their honeymoon. Sofia La Rosa is preparing for her big Milan Fashion Week show when Ivan, a psycho Russian Bratva killer, starts tracking her. Sofia knows what he wants and is unwilling to part with the information. When her overprotective brothers ask Enzo, the love of Sofia’s life, to help protect Sofia when she is in Milan for her fashion show, Sofia knows it is a bad idea.

Enzo Vitale is poised to take over the family to become the Don. Enzo can’t seem to move past what he witnessed four years ago when he rescued his sister from the clutches of a human trafficking ring. Since then he has distanced himself from everyone but especially the one matters the most, Sofia. Now she needs his protection from Ivan and the Russians. Will this be his chance to show Sofia that they can be together?

I didn’t want to tear myself away! There is so much action with so many players. I love all the twists and the secret players. Is Katya a friend or a foe? Will Elena ever get to come home? If I wasn’t hooked after the first one, I am definitely hooked now! I love this series.
